The origin of the Manno surname is uncertain. It is believed to be of Italian origin, possibly derived from the Latin name “Mannus,” meaning “man.” It is also possible that the name is derived from the German word “man,” meaning “man.” The Manno family has a long and proud history. It is believed that the first Manno's arrived in Italy in the 11th century. They were part of a large group of immigrants who settled in the region of Calabria. Over time, the Manno's spread throughout the country, eventually settling in all the regions of Italy. The Manno family has a strong cultural heritage. They are known for their strong work ethic and loyalty to family. They are also known for their strong sense of justice and fair play. Variations of the Manno surname include Manner, Mannino, Mannari, Manieri, and Mannora. The Manno family is also known for its many variations in spelling, such as Mano, Manoni, Manoni, Manonni, and Monno. The Manno surname is still common today in Italy, and can be found in many other countries around the world, including the United States, Canada, Australia, and the United Kingdom.
